On September 19, 2012, Teck reached agreement with Westshore Terminals Limited Partnership to extend the parties’ current handling agreement (previously set to expire March 31, 2016) for an additional five year term, now set to expire March 31, 2021. This extended contract will require Teck to ship not less than 16 million tonnes and up to 19 million tonnes of coal per contract year from its six western Canadian coal operations. Teck is the world’s second largest seaborne exporter of steelmaking coal. Teck’s main business segments are coal, copper, zinc and energy products. For the third straight year, Teck was named to the 2012 Dow Jones Sustainability World Index.

Teck was represented on the matter by Vancouver Partner, François Tougas, and by Vancouver Associate, Ryan Gallagher.
